Irreducibility of Equisingular Families of Curves - Improved Conditions

In math.AG/0108089 we gave sufficient conditions for the irreducibility of the family V of irreducible curves in the linear system |D| with precisely r singular points of topological respectively analytical types S1,...,Sr on several classes of smooth projective surfaces S. The conditions where of the form (tau'(S1)+2)^2 +...+ (tau'(Sr)+2)^2 < c*(D-K)^2, where tau' is some invariant of singularity types, K is the canonical divisor of S and c is some constant. In the present paper we improve this condition, that is the constant c, by a factor 9.
